Output ef3d5006dd197d169a3244fc4b6dd16b6dba5a3aa9c36bc803d26fc116aca4ec:2

value
163752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f2d045d2941b7aa3fa55739e07b01d6c80e3b60 OP_EQUAL
address
3LaTj6HLAYpTyAcoDdb8Da7xDv9Lh6wxco
transaction
ef3d5006dd197d169a3244fc4b6dd16b6dba5a3aa9c36bc803d26fc116aca4ec
confirmations
170942
spent
true